Got some progress on testing the mold. The guys were able to pull a part in clear. We tried some "cell cast" material that we found out was Chinese. It didn't form the same as the known material we had. Apparently, it's "somehow" different. When we do production we may have to do a special order to a US manufacturer to get these right

We also have to make some changes to the fiberglass to make it a more usable piece.

These we plan to have production going in March. I'd love to say earlier, but anything is possible. We have some stock of the old fiberglass but have a meeting with a potential vendor for helping us improve these and maybe do a few other fiberglass parts.

QUOTE(wayner @ Jan 4 2017, 07:20 PM) *

I just learned of this new top but I don't know anything about them.

Care to educate a newbie?
What are the benefits?

Well if you are from Oregon where a lot of sunshine is liquid it's often the only way to feel you have the top off. There was a Saratoga top that was made in the 70s-80s and it was poorly fitted I decided to make this using a fiberglass structure to be able to use factory seals and hardware. Making it seal about as well as the factory roof.

Clear is an option. going to start fixtures Monday
